Private 2-Bedroom Cabin on 45 Wooded Acres – Spencer, West Virginia
Tucked away on 45 secluded, wooded acres near Spencer, West Virginia, this charming 2-bedroom, 1-bathroom cabin offers a peaceful escape for those seeking a simpler lifestyle or a quiet off-grid retreat.
Originally built in 1932, the 768-square-foot cabin includes a full kitchen, living area, and bathroom. It’s equipped with a pellet stove, gas space heaters, electric service, and a drilled water well. A tankless on-demand water heater is also installed. According to the owner, the property benefits from free gas and holds marketable timber potential.
Whether you’re into hiking, hunting, or riding four-wheelers, the land offers plenty of space for outdoor activities. Located just five miles from both Charles Fork Lake and the town of Spencer, you’ll have convenient access to supplies while enjoying full privacy.
This property could serve as a cozy full-time residence, a weekend getaway, or temporary housing while building your dream home. Best of all, the annual property tax is just \$113—making this an affordable opportunity to own a slice of West Virginia wilderness.
